Abstract :
Presented paper is devoted to theoretical modeling and experimental investigation of transferring of initial phase of low frequency oscillations with modulation of carrier oscillations in separate high frequency link from one part of testing link to another. The main goal of this investigation is the determination of influence of phase stability and amplitude one of separate high frequency link on the phase stability of low frequency oscillations in a point of reception. The results of experimental investigation of the reference oscillator´s synchronization channel are represented in the paper.
